The Kodak EasyShare ZD710 combines a seven megapixel CCD imager and a Schneider-Kreuznach Variogon-branded 10x optical zoom lens with a very useful 38 - 380mm equivalent focal range. The ZD710 offers digital image stabilization, which prevent blurs due to camera shake. For framing images, the Kodak ZD710 has a 2.0″ 150K pixel LCD display as well as a higher resolution 201K pixel electronic viewfinder. Images are stored on SDHC/SD/MMC memory cards, or in 32MB of internal memory.
